Abstract:
We report temporal changes in sputum rheological parameters after SARS-CoV-2 infection in two patients with chronic cough (71-year-old, male, sinobronchial syndrome; 80-year-old, female, cough variant asthma). Both patients complained of decreased cough-related quality of life and increased phlegm stickiness after infection. In parallel, their sputum showed decreases in linear viscoelastic region (LVR) parameters, such as viscoelastic modulus (G∗), elastic modulus (G'), and viscous modulus (G″), and increased tack (tan δ/G'; tan δ = G″/G') compared to pre-infection levels. Rheological parameters, such as G∗ and tack, took at least several months to return to almost pre-infection levels after recovery from COVID-19. Further studies are needed to determine whether the viscoelastic fluctuations seen in these two patients are common to patients with post-COVID-19 cough and whether their delayed recovery is associated with prolonged clinical symptoms. A sputum rheology approach may provide new insights into post-COVID-19 cough.

Sputum Studies II: Culture and Sensitivity
Sputum culture and sensitivity is a medical procedure used to diagnose bacterial infections in the respiratory tract and select the most appropriate antibiotics for treatment. This process involves analyzing sputum samples of thick and opaque secretions produced in the lungs and airways. These samples are collected from patients and then sent to the laboratory for analysis.
